Transaction 629f507b2ea34f724a0eaa4ddf03af502f768b0f1a5e219a17dcf7510814795f

1 Input
2 Outputs
  • 629f507b2ea34f724a0eaa4ddf03af502f768b0f1a5e219a17dcf7510814795f:0
  • value  6330753
    address  3DxeRf5XHuXYm9DWHdascapn1D1LvTs8do
  • 629f507b2ea34f724a0eaa4ddf03af502f768b0f1a5e219a17dcf7510814795f:1
  • value  22599132
    address  34z6xj23XHvrP3z5hT7wNvQSG5HU2Ghh2h